By default, Thunderbird doesn't use KDE-dialogs when running under
Kubuntu, which can be changed by editing /usr/lib/mozilla-
thunderbird/components/nsFilePicker.js like described for Firefox in
http://ubuntuforums.org/showthread.php?t=110353 . This is quite some
pain, since it has to be done every time Thunderbird gets updated.

The preferable solution would be to supply a Thunderbird-KDE-
integration-package, or at least putting nsFilePicker.js under
/etc/[mozilla-]thunderbird/, so that user-made changes won't get wasted
after each update.

Btw, in Thunderbird 1.0.x one could "dpkg-reconfigure mozilla-
thunderbird" to manually update the Thunderbird Chrome Registry to
enable changes made in nsFilePicker.js, which unfortunately doesn't work
for Thunderbird 1.5.x anymore :-(
